The crystal structure of a high T c superconductor, Ba 2 YCu 3 O 7- x , has been refined by the Rietveld analysis of TOF neutron powder diffraction data. Two polymorphs of Ba 2 YCu 3 O 7- x are contained in the sample: orthorhombic (74%) and tetragonal (26%) forms. The two forms have nearly the same structure closely related to that of perovskite-type compounds. In the orthorhombic form, the occupation factor of an oxygen atom on the a axis differed greatly from that on the b axis, which is the main reason why Ba 2 YCu 3 O 7- x crystallizes in the orthorhombic form.
